(i) A, B, C, D, E and Fare six members in a family a family in which there are two married couples.
(ii) D is the brother of F. Both D and F are lighter than B.
(iii) B is the mother of D and lighter than E.
(iv) C , a lady, is neither the beaviest nor the lightest in the family.
(v) E is lighter than C.
(vi) The grandfather is the heaviest in the family.
Which of the following is a pair of married couples ?

Let us contruct the family tree on the one hand and the line (in ascending order) of weight on the other. Let us take all the informations about weights.
These informations are : (i) Both D and F are lighter than B.
(ii) B is lighter than E.
(iii) C is neither the heaviest nor the lightest.
(iv) E is lighter than C.
(v) The grandfather is the heaviest.
The corresponding accomodations can be made pictorially as :
(i) D, `F lt B`
(ii) ` B lt E`
(iii) ....C... (C is not at any extreme)
(iv) `E lt C`
(v) all `lt` grandfather.
This can be accomodated in one diagram as,
`D, F lt B lt E lt C lt` grandfather.
obviously, the grandfather must be A. Hence,
`D, F lt B lt E lt C lt A` (grandfather).
Now, we take the family tree. The relevant informations are :
(i) There are two married couples.
(ii) D is the brother of F.
(iii) B is the mother of D.
(iv) C is a female.
Let us start with (iii). It can be represented as:
Now, to complete this tree, we have only three additional informations One, that A is the grandfather, two, that there are two married couples and three, that C is a female. This, obviously, is insufficient to complete the family tree. A could either be married to B or C. Or, he may as well be married to E, whose sex is unknown. Thus we see that as far as relations are concerned, we find .data inadequate for all the questions. Hence. our answers are:
